How to Install and Uninstall crypt++el Package on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)

Last updated: May 16,2024

1. Install "crypt++el" package

Please follow the guidelines below to install crypt++el on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install crypt++el

2. Uninstall "crypt++el"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all crypt++el on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ish):

$ sudo apt remove crypt++el $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
